It Feels Like Home Episode 8 Episode Summary

In this episode of “The Balancing Act,” viewers are in for an exciting and informative ride as the show takes them on a journey that truly feels like home. Airing on Lifetime, this episode titled “It Feels Like Home” covers a range of topics that are sure to resonate with a diverse audience.

One of the highlights of this episode is a visit to Bacon City, where viewers can immerse themselves in the world of everyone’s favorite crispy delight—bacon. From learning about the history of bacon to discovering simple-to-prepare recipes that incorporate this beloved ingredient, bacon enthusiasts are in for a treat.

For those looking to bring a touch of greenery into their living spaces, “The Balancing Act” has you covered. This episode provides valuable insights on starting an indoor home garden, making it easier than ever to cultivate plants and herbs right in the comfort of your own home.

Additionally, the show offers valuable tips on finding the perfect apartment to suit any lifestyle. Whether you’re a city dweller or prefer a more suburban setting, the guidance provided in this segment will help you navigate the apartment-hunting process with confidence.

The Balancing Act Series Information

It's all about finding a balance between home and family, work and relationships, and the hosts of "The Balancing Act" are on a mission to help people find a balance that works for them. Each day's episode has a different theme -- Mondays are targeted to self-improvement, Tuesdays are about family, Wednesdays are focused on money, Thursday is dedicated to the home, and Fridays are for planning the weekend.
